Indonesia presents a fascinating study in contrasts for market researchers and business analysts. Jakarta's sprawling commercial districts reveal Southeast Asia's fastest-growing consumer markets, while Bali's Canggu and Ubud neighborhoods showcase the digital economy's impact on traditional communities. The archipelago's 17,000 islands create distinct regional markets—from Surabaya's manufacturing corridors to Medan's agricultural trade networks. Staying in residential neighborhoods rather than business hotels offers unfiltered access to local commerce patterns, family spending habits, and the informal economy that still drives much of Indonesian daily life.

How does home exchange on SwappaHome work?

You list your home, earn 1 credit for every night you host a guest, and spend those credits to stay at any other home in the network — always 1 credit per night. No money changes hands between members. New accounts start with 10 free credits, so you can book your first trip before you've hosted anyone.

Is it safe to swap homes with strangers?

Every member goes through identity verification before they can list or book. All messages run through our encrypted chat. After each stay, guests and hosts leave mutual reviews — reputation is the foundation of the whole community, and members with low ratings lose access. For extra peace of mind, we recommend confirming house rules in writing before arrival.

Do I need to swap directly with the same person?

No. SwappaHome uses a credit system, not direct 1-to-1 swaps. You can host a family from Berlin and use the credits you earn to stay with a completely different host in Tokyo six months later. It makes travel dates, destinations and group sizes much easier to match.

Can I join if I don't own a home?

Yes — you can earn credits by hosting in a spare room, a long-term rental (if your lease allows guests) or by gifting/receiving credits from other members. You can also buy a starter pack if you want to travel before you host. Listing your primary home is the most common path, but it's not the only one.

What makes Indonesia valuable for market analysis and consumer research?

Indonesia's 270+ million population represents the world's fourth-largest consumer market, with a rapidly expanding middle class and mobile-first digital adoption rates that outpace infrastructure development. The country offers live case studies in leapfrog technology, informal retail ecosystems, and multi-generational household purchasing decisions. Regional variations are extreme—what sells in Java differs vastly from Sulawesi—making ground-level observation essential. Markets, warungs, and residential areas reveal consumer behavior that surveys often miss, particularly around brand loyalty, price sensitivity, and the blend of traditional and modern commerce.
